My "new" 94 90CS is nice and secure in front of the house, but
unfortunately I cannot convince my 2yr old to reveal what he did with
the keys!!

Anyhow, here's my plan (open for input):

Call AAA to pop open the door.
Assuming they can do this with "slim jim" or such?

Pop the hood and disconnect the battery.

Pull the deriver's door lock cylinder and have locksmith cut a new key.
Dealer was not sure if key codes would be on any other cylinders.
Anyone know if the codes would be on the trunk lock cylinder and if so,
would that be any easier to get at than the driver's door?
Suspect that I need to pull the door panel to get it out?    Any BTDT
for pulling the lock cylinder would be appreciated.

I've been holding until Christmas for getting a Bentley.
In the meantime might someone be able to tell me what reprogramming a
new keyless remote would entail.  The dealer mentioned needing 2 keys
and "pushing a few buttons."
